Overview

The VS International Conference on Evolutionary Game Theory vs Complex Systems brings together two disciplines that have traditionally been at odds. Evolutionary game theory, with its roots in economics and biology, seeks to understand how strategic interactions shape the behavior of individuals and populations. Complex systems, on the other hand, focus on the emergent properties of interconnected networks and systems. As researchers from both fields converge, they must navigate the tensions between reductionism and holism, individual agency and collective behavior, and equilibrium and dynamics. 🌐 Introduction to Evolutionary Game Theory

Evolutionary game theory, a field that combines Evolutionary Biology and Game Theory, has been increasingly applied to understand the behavior of complex systems. The concept of Evolutionary Stability, introduced by John Maynard Smith, has been instrumental in shaping the field.
